This episode unfolds in two parts.
In the mid 1990's, Former Defense Secretary Robert McNamara wrote a book in which he describes what he called the mistakes his generation of leadership had made in Vietnam and his thoughts on how future generations could avoid them. He admits they were wrong. McNamara has often been criticized by historians, even in our series we used one interview with Michael Beschloss where he described McNamara's representations critically from this very book. So I thought we should here from the man himself. This was his appearance, in 1996, with Ted Koppel on the ABC News show " Nightline"
Then we pick up where we left off with an escalating war in South East Asia and the protests it set off here at home. Here you can hear some of the hearings started by Senator William Fulbright, and the aggressive voicing of concerns from Oregon Senator Wayne Morse, and we can listen in as President Lyndon Johnson tries to control it all, to no avail, as the war grows to a half a million men in a full scale land war in Asia, and lays the ground work for a political explosion in 1968, a Presidential election year.
